5 Simple Statements About Atomic Explained
5 Simple Statements About Atomic Explained
Blog Article
Can somebody clarify to me, whats the difference between atomic operations and atomic transactions? Its appears to me that both of these are a similar thing.Is that correct?
There are actually numerous diverse variants of how these things operate dependant upon whether or not the Attributes are scalar values or objects, And just how keep, duplicate, readonly, nonatomic, etcetera interact. Usually the residence synthesizers just learn how to do the "right issue" for all mixtures.
We are able to only assure which the app is suitable with the latest steady Fedora release, so be certain your process is up to date. If it isn't really, backup your facts and Stick to the DNF System Update manual to update your system to the current launch.
Here is the intriguing part: Performance using atomic assets accesses in uncontested (e.g. solitary-threaded) cases is usually really pretty rapidly in some instances. In below excellent circumstances, usage of atomic accesses can Charge more than twenty instances the overhead of nonatomic.
An atom is neither a reliable item nor the smallest device known to scientists. As a substitute, an atom is made of numerous particles that interact In keeping with specific procedures. At its Main, an atom is actually a nucleus surrounded by a cloud of electrons.
Your statement is only legitimate for architectures that present this sort of warranty of atomicity for merchants and/or masses. You'll find architectures that don't do this.
divisible. However the dbms does one among two factors with one values which have sections. The dbms either returns These values in general, or maybe the dbms
Regrettably, "atomic = non-relation" just isn't what you're going to hear. (Sadly Codd was not the clearest author and his expository remarks get bewildered together with his base line.
benefit is always returned in the getter or set from the setter, no matter setter activity on every other Atomic thread.
"Ham and eggs" only jumped by 1 Although two persons voted for it! This is often Plainly not what we required. If only there was an atomic operation "increment if it exists or come up with a new file"... for brevity, let us get in touch with it "upsert" (for "update or insert")
atom, The fundamental making block of all issue and chemistry. Atoms can Merge with other atoms to sort molecules but can't be divided into scaled-down pieces by everyday chemical procedures.
You'll want to use the correct technology for your needs, needs, and skills. Hopefully this could save you several several hours of comparisons, and help you make an improved knowledgeable final decision when designing your plans.
So, For illustration, in the context of the databases program, a single can have 'atomic commits', meaning that you can force a changeset of updates to your relational databases and people adjustments will either all be submitted, or none of these in any way during the celebration of failure, in this way data would not turn out to be corrupt, and consequential of locks and/or queues, another operation will probably be another write or simply a read through, but only following
As an example, if somebody is scheduling a flight, you wish to each get payment AND reserve the seat OR do neither. If possibly a person had been permitted to realize success with no other also succeeding, the database would be inconsistent.